SPCC is undeniably among HK's top schools alongside a couple of others. Their students - more than often - achieve rather impressive results academically. They have a long tradition of music excellence, and are doing well in some sports among co-ed schools (SPCC, unlike some elite schools, is not quite keen on 'poaching' star athletes).
Most of their students are rather humble despite their 'better-than-average' background and upbringing.
No one dare to say that SPCC (or any other school) is the best choice. It all depends on the kid and his/her parents' expectations. Good luck.
